Save display times in the db
This commit is contained in:
@@ -1,4 +1,6 @@
|
||||
class CompletionsController < ApplicationController
|
||||
include CompletionsConcern
|
||||
|
||||
before_action :set_contest
|
||||
before_action :set_data, only: %i[ create edit new update ]
|
||||
before_action :set_completion, only: %i[ destroy edit update ]
|
||||
@@ -25,6 +27,7 @@ class CompletionsController < ApplicationController
|
||||
@completion = Completion.new(completion_params)
|
||||
@completion.contest_id = @contest.id
|
||||
if @completion.save
|
||||
extend_completions!(@completion.contestant)
|
||||
redirect_to contest_path(@contest)
|
||||
else
|
||||
logger = Logger.new(STDOUT)
|
||||
@@ -41,6 +44,7 @@ class CompletionsController < ApplicationController
|
||||
@completion.contestant_id = params[:contestant_id]
|
||||
end
|
||||
if @completion.update(completion_params)
|
||||
extend_completions!(@completion.contestant)
|
||||
redirect_to @contest
|
||||
else
|
||||
@title = "Edit completion"
|
||||
|
||||
Reference in New Issue
Block a user